Tender description

The National Policing Improvement Agency (NPIA) is re-launching its High Potential Development Scheme (HPDS). We would like to work with one or more academic partners on strategically important collaborations to develop and implement a series of high level leadership programmes to be designed to take police leadership in the United Kingdom into the 21st Century. Within our Leadership Strategy are four leadership development programmes that are scheduled to be launched over the next 2 years, commencing with the High Potential Development Scheme. Following rigorous selection these programmes require candidates to undergo development to equip them to be future senior leaders. The NPIA seeks expressions of interest from academic partners to collaborate with the NPIA. This is to establish, accredit and provide academic assurance for these programmes to enable candidates to achieve, as part of their development, recognised qualifications at post-graduate level. This will involve design, co-delivery and assessment of candidates’ work at the cutting edge of leadership training. Potential partners should be an accrediting authority and experienced in working with large corporate & public sector organisations in leadership development programmes. This represents a unique opportunity to be part of a high-profile, national leadership programme supported by the Home Office, Association of Police Authorities and the Association of Chief Police Officers. Closing date for registration: 28th March 2008. The NPIA is completely committed to the promotion of equality and diversity, and we welcome working with Partners who share our commitment.
